SCG3497 - Austria 1999 – 100 Years Graz Opera House
1 in stock
Issued in 1999, this Austrian commemorative stamp celebrates the centenary of the Graz Opera House (Grazer Opernhaus), a key institution in Austria’s cultural landscape. The design features an allegorical female figure in classical robes, representing music and the arts, holding a lyre and gesturing toward the opulent opera setting in the background. The vivid red drapery and ornate column emphasize the grandeur of the venue. The top left includes the "Bühnen Graz" (Graz Theatres) logo.
Face Value: 6.50 Schilling
Designer: M. Siegl
Engraver: G. Schmirl
